Official product description

Cevimeline Hydrochloride Capsules, 30 mg a) 100 count bottle, and b) 500 count bottle, Rx Only, Manufactured by: Apotex Research Pvt., Ltd., Bangalore, India, Manufactured for: Apotex Corp, Westin, FL, a) NDC 60505-3145-1, b) NDC 60505-3145-5

Why the product was recalled

Failed Stability Specifications: product may not meet specification limit for assay test.

Distribution information

Nationwide and Puerto Rico

How to read the classification

FDA Class II indicates a situation in which use of or exposure to the product may cause temporary or medically reversible adverse health consequences, or where the probability of serious consequences is remote. The classification shown here comes from the FDA record.
